    Quote Originally Posted by cookie09:
    you are assuming that Switzerland edges Brazil off the first spot in Group E. I like the idea but pretty bold prediction
    Its actually impossible for those 4 teams to all make the semi finals as they are all in the same side of the draw and Brazil/Switzerlands group play Germany's group in the last 16 anyway so only two of those teams can go through to the last 8.
